After losing the "Battle of Yonghu", Curry showed a heartwarming side and gave away two signed jerseys

Although the NBA Warriors lost to the Lakers 108-118 on the 26th Beijing time, Curry, the first brother of the Warriors, still showed a heartwarming side after the game and gave two signed jerseys to the children of Lakers head coach Redick.

Redick (left), Curry (right).

Redick has opted to live on a loan from Pacific Palisades since becoming Lakers coach last year. However, the Palisades fire in Los Angeles, California, earlier this month left them with many important items that they could not replace, including the basketball collection of Redick's two sons, Knox and Kai.

"All the important things we've had for the last 20 years of living together and raising children are in that house, and there are things that can't be replaced, never replaceable." Reddick said in an interview on January 11.

Reddick stressed that the material loss was only secondary, and more importantly, that his family was digesting the pain of losing their home: "That feeling is really bad, and you would never want anyone to go through something like this. ”
